Women MPs surrounded PM Modi’s chair in Lok Sabha

New Delhi: Prime Minister Narendra Modi was to reply to the discussion on the motion of thanks on the President’s address at 5 pm today, but due to the uproar, the proceedings of the House had to be adjourned till tomorrow morning. Due to this, PM Modi’s address was postponed. At the same time, Bharatiya Janata Party has made a big allegation against Congress. BJP alleged that opposition women MPs were sent to PM Modi’s chair. BJP MP Manoj Tiwari alleged that their aim was to attack BJP MPs.

7 women MPs surrounded PM Modi’s chair

In fact, under the leadership of Varsha Gaikwad, about 7 women MPs surrounded PM Modi’s chair. They surrounded PM Modi’s chair with a big banner. The rest of the Congress MPs standing in the well were waving placards. PM Modi had reached Parliament at that time. Was sitting in his office. The strategy of Congress MPs was to stop Modi from reaching his seat as soon as he entered the House. However, Sandhya Rai, who was sitting on the Speaker’s chair at that time, tried to convince the MPs who were creating ruckus. But as the uproar continued, within one and a half minutes Sandhya Rai adjourned the proceedings of the Lok Sabha till tomorrow.

What did BJP say?

BJP MP Manoj Tiwari said that what happened today in the House had never happened before. Congress had conspired to attack BJP leaders by putting forward women MPs. Congress women MPs had reached Nishikant Dubey’s chair. Law Minister Arjun Ram Meghwal said that today Congress has done a bad thing by putting forward women MPs. Meghwal said that the Gandhi-Nehru family considers its birthright to power. They are not able to tolerate that how a poor backward class person became the Prime Minister of the country and why is he getting the blessings of the public again and again?

Congress enraged by Nishikant Dubey’s speech

Actually, today Nishikant Dubey arrived with a full bundle of books and started telling the history of Congress leaders in the House. Congress MPs created a ruckus on this. Then the Congress MPs reached the Speaker’s chamber and there was heavy sloganeering. During this time, MPs from the ruling party including Parliamentary Affairs Minister Kiren Rijiju were also present there. Congress leaders also debated with Kiren Rijiju. Opposition MPs demanded action against Nishikant Dubey. The Speaker calmed the matter by saying that the opposition leaders should submit their complaint in writing. They will think about it. After this, Congress leaders protested outside the House.
